West Brom and Northern Ireland star Chris Brunt is a doubt for Euro 2016 after suffering a knee injury in Saturday's 3-2 win over Crystal Palace.

The 31-year-old suffered what may be a cruciate ligament injury when he fell awkwardly just before half-time.

Brunt, who was hit by a coin thrown by his own fans last week, has undergone a scan.

Image: WBA fans hold a banner to show their support for Brunt

Baggies fans sang his name on 11 minutes against Palace in a show of support, and collected money for chosen charities.

Boss Tony Pulis said: "We're concerned about him. Looks as though he's done something to the knee joint.
